Transaction 3f1816ed637cddfde60f214b9f8441a8cb7527cdc556854aef2de0520a291ff3

1 Input
2 Outputs
  • 3f1816ed637cddfde60f214b9f8441a8cb7527cdc556854aef2de0520a291ff3:0
  • value  25000000
    address  16hHPX3RuAnRydc1X52DgqPWE2qxz1WPQg
  • 3f1816ed637cddfde60f214b9f8441a8cb7527cdc556854aef2de0520a291ff3:1
  • value  34598832
    address  37FoZKUXQ52SJ4hHf8SrWbXxLTW6RUCXsw